Perennials for the Southwest Summary

Perennials for the Southwest by Mary Irish

Drawing upon her vast knowledge of perennials and how they perform in the arid Southwest, Mary Irish has produced the definitive guide for gardeners who want to create lush, colorful gardens while keeping artificial irrigation to a minimum. This book will help Southwest gardeners meet the challenge of growing perennials successfully by providing inspired, practical information on how to design dry-climate gardens and an A-Z guide to 156 proven plants. Each entry includes the plant's scientific and common names, distribution, cultural needs, drought tolerance, and ornamental characteristics. Written in a clear, reader-friendly style and profusely illustrated with sparkling color photographs, this invaluable volume makes Irish's expertise available to every gardener.

About Mary Irish

Mary Irish is a prominent voice in southwestern horticulture and has written extensively on dry-climate gardening. She received her master's degree in geography from Texas A&M University and is the former director of public horticulture at the Desert Botanical Garden in Phoenix. A Texas native, Mary grew up raising farm animals and tending a large vegetable garden. In 1985 Mary and her husband Gary moved to Phoenix, Arizona, and before long she began working as a volunteer at the Desert Botanical Garden, where she soon earned a full-time position. Mary once hosted a weekly Phoenix-based radio show called The Arizona Gardener, and has appeared on countless news and lifestyle television programs regarding desert gardening. She is a regular contributor to several magazines including Sunset, and teaches classes on the care and culture of agaves, cacti, and other desert shrubs.
